What is Retinol? 

First, let’s break down what retinol is. Retinol is a fat-soluble form of vitamin A and is a key ingredient in anti-aging and anti-acne skincare products. While you are browsing online for your next skincare investment, you’re bound to find moisturizers, serums, eye creams, and just about every other type of product containing retinol (sometimes called retinoids, retinaldehyde, Retin-A). 

 

How Does Retinol Work? 

The most significant aspect of what gives retinol such great results is its ability to increase skin cell turnover. As we age, our skin cell turnover slows down, leading to signs of aging. Retinol speeds up this process, bringing the younger, healthier, damage-free skin cells to the surface much faster. This can improve many aspects of the skin’s appearance, including fine lines and wrinkles, pigmentation and age spots, and skin tone and texture.

What to Avoid When Using Retinol 

So, it is clear that retinol is an incredible ingredient. But it does come with some caution. Firstly, not everyone’s skin can tolerate retinol. If you have sensitive skin or suffer from rosacea, retinol might not be for you. If you are going to give retinol a try, here are some important things to avoid during the process. 

 

Sun Exposure 

Retinol will make your skin much more vulnerable to damaging UV rays. Firstly, apply your retinol product at night, and secondly, make sure you use SPF protection (minimum of 30) during the day to protect your skin. 

 

Don’t Mix With Certain Ingredients 

While it’s fine to mix retinol with moisturizing ingredients like hyaluronic acid, retinol should not be mixed with AHA’s/BHA’s, vitamin C, or benzoyl peroxide. AHA’s and BHA’s both exfoliate the skin, so using them with retinol could increase irritation and dryness. If you are using vitamin C, it’s best to use that in the morning and your retinol at night. Finally, if you use benzoyl peroxide to treat acne, don’t mix it with retinol, as these two ingredients cancel each other out.

Potential Side-Effects 

If you’re using retinol for the first time, you can expect some possible side effects. Side effects can include flaky skin, sensitivity and dryness. These side effects are normal, and your skin needs time to adjust to the new active ingredient. Incorporate retinol into your skincare routine slowly so your skin can build up its tolerance. If you find the side effects too much, stay on the safe side and discontinue use.
